Decoding Your Dog's Language

Your furry companion expresses their world with you in a language all its own. Though they may not speak copyright, their tail wags, ear positions, and even their body language can reveal a wealth of information about how they're feeling. Decoding these subtle cues can strengthen your bond and create a more harmonious relationship with your canine partner.

A wagging tail doesn't always signal happiness. The speed, direction, and flexibility of the wag can tell you if your dog is excited, anxious, or even defensive. Likewise, a raised hackle often indicates fear or aggression, while lowered ears can show submission or anxiety.

Paying attention to your dog's overall attitude can give you even deeper insights. Do they greet with strangers eagerly? Are they focused when you speak to them? These are all important pieces of the puzzle that can help you deeply understand your dog's inner world.

Animal Safety: Keeping Your Best Friend Safe

Bringing a new furry companion into your life is an exciting experience. But with new excitement comes the responsibility of ensuring their safety and well-being. Each pet, regardless of size or species, deserves a safe and nurturing environment.

Here are some essential tips to keep your best friend happy:

* Keep an eye on interactions between your saznajte više pet and young children. Teach kids how to interact gently with your furry friend.

* Make sure your yard is securely fenced to prevent escapes and potential dangers.

* Store potentially harmful substances like cleaning products, medications, and toxic plants in a safe location.

* Provide your pet with plenty of fresh liquid and nutritious food to keep them healthy.

* Regularly groom to prevent mats and tangles, and check for fleas and ticks.

Remember, being a responsible pet owner means putting their needs first. By following these simple tips, you can help ensure that your furry companion lives a long, joyful life.

Traveling with Your Pets: A Guide to Stress-Free Adventures

Embarking upon a grand vacation with your furry pal? It can be an fantastic experience for both you and your pet, but proper consideration is key to ensuring a stress-free trip. First ideas first, make sure your pet is healthy enough for travel. A visit with your veterinarian can help assess any potential issues and ensure they are up-to-date on vaccinations.

Next, gather all the essential items your pet will need. This entails food, water, a comfortable bed, their favorite snacks, and any necessary medication. Refrain from forgetting essential documents like your pet's vaccination records and identification tags. When traveling by vehicle, make sure your pet is securely confined in a crate to prevent harm. If you are flying, be positive to check the airline's guidelines regarding pets.
